WebThe Eagles were unquestionably the biggest mainstream American rock band to emerge in the 1970s. Not only did they sell more records and concert tickets than their peers -- Their Greatest Hits (1971-1975) and Hotel California are two of the biggest-selling albums of all time -- but they captured the shifting zeitgeist of the '70s, riding the country-rock hippie … crack plumber

WebEagles is the debut studio album by American rock band the Eagles. The album was recorded at London's Olympic Studios with producer Glyn Johns and released in 1972. The album was an immediate success for the young band, reaching No. 22 on the charts and going platinum. Three singles were released from the album, each reaching the Top 40: …
